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3654647 419 0197871 61046756561 040545
2939922750 80102670964
2939922750 80102670964
13323 85877 6175867
All about undefined
Interested in learning more?
2939922750 80102670964
13323 85877 6175867
See more
1825 9532
33492095137 944185 51854
See more
919017497 7905775189 96
86 6758450809 367462416 7512 5691713
See more